Know What You Can Comfortably Afford
 
 
Probably the most important first-time home buyer ideas is to deal with what you may comfortably afford, not just what a lender says it's possible you'll qualify for. Your month-to-month mortgage payment is only one part of the total cost of homeownership. You additionally have to consider property taxes, homeowners insurance, utilities, maintenance, and attainable HOA fees.
 
 
A real estate agent in Acworth GA will often inform first-time buyers to set a realistic budget early. Look at your present bills, your financial savings goals, and the way much monetary flexibility you need after moving in. Buying on the very top of your budget can depart little room for unexpected repairs or life changes.
 
 
Get Pre-Approved Earlier than You Start Shopping
 
 
Getting pre-approved for a mortgage is likely one of the smartest steps you can take before touring homes. A pre-approval gives you a clearer picture of your value range and shows sellers that you are a severe buyer. In a competitive market, this can make your offer much stronger.
 
 
Many first-time buyers make the mistake of browsing homes on-line earlier than speaking with a lender. While it is fine to get inspired, it is much more productive to start your search once you know your financing details. A real estate agent can also use your pre-approval quantity to assist slim down homes that actually fit your budget and goals.

Do Not Skip the Home Inspection
 
 
A home might look perfect during a showing, however appearances don't always inform the total story. A professional home inspection is essential for first-time buyers because it can reveal issues with the roof, plumbing, electrical systems, HVAC, foundation, and more.
 
 
Skipping the inspection to make your supply more interesting can be risky, especially in the event you don't have expertise recognizing warning signs. A real estate agent can guide you through this step and allow you to understand which inspection findings are minor and which ones may require negotiation or a second look.
 
 
Be Ready for Closing Costs and Other Upfront Bills
 
 
Another vital first-time home buyer tip is to avoid wasting for more than just the down payment. Closing costs can embody lender fees, appraisal fees, title services, prepaid taxes, and homeowners insurance. In addition, it's possible you'll need cash for moving expenses, utility deposits, and instant repairs or updates.
 
 
Planning ahead helps reduce final-minute stress. Your real estate agent and lender can explain the expected upfront costs so you may put together realistically instead of being caught off guard close to closing.

Avoid Main Monetary Changes In the course of the Process
 
 
Once you're pre-approved and actively house hunting, it is essential to keep your finances stable. Avoid opening new credit cards, financing a car, changing jobs without careful consideration, or making large unexplained deposits into your bank account. These changes can affect your loan approval and create problems late within the process.
 
 
Numerous first-time buyers don't realize that lenders often review financial details again earlier than closing. Staying financially consistent may also help your transaction keep on track.
